Essential Materials and Tools
Before starting any DIY drapery project, gather these essential materials and tools:
- Fabric: Choose a fabric that complements your room's theme. Cotton and linen are beginner-friendly options.
- Sewing Machine: While hand-sewing is possible, a machine will speed up the process.
- Measuring Tape: Accurate measurements are crucial for a professional finish.
- Scissors: Ensure they are sharp for clean cuts.
- Pins and Needles: For holding fabric in place and finishing touches.
- Iron: Pressing fabric helps achieve crisp lines and a polished look.
Project 1: Simple Rod Pocket Curtains
Step-by-Step Instructions
Rod pocket curtains are a classic and versatile choice for any room. Here's how to create them:
- Measure Your Windows: Determine the width and length of the fabric needed, adding extra for seams and hems.
- Cut the Fabric: Use your measurements to cut the fabric accordingly.
- Sew the Hem: Fold the edges of the fabric and sew a hem to prevent fraying.
- Create the Rod Pocket: Fold the top edge of the fabric over to form a pocket for the curtain rod, and sew along the edge.
- Press and Hang: Iron the curtains to remove any wrinkles, then slide them onto the rod and hang them.
Project 2: No-Sew Drop Cloth Curtains
Step-by-Step Instructions
If sewing isn’t your forte, try this no-sew option using a drop cloth:
- Select a Drop Cloth: Choose a size that fits your window dimensions.
- Wash and Iron: Clean and press the drop cloth to remove any creases.
- Attach Clip Rings: Use clip rings at the top of the cloth to hang it from the curtain rod.
- Style and Adjust: Arrange the folds and adjust the length as needed for a relaxed, casual look.
Project 3: Tie-Dye Sheer Curtains
Step-by-Step Instructions
Tie-dye is making a comeback in 2026, and it’s a fun way to add color to sheer curtains:
- Choose Sheer Fabric: Opt for lightweight materials like voile or chiffon.
- Create Tie-Dye Patterns: Use rubber bands to tie sections of the fabric.
- Dye the Fabric: Apply fabric dye according to the instructions, then rinse and dry.
- Finish and Hang: Hem the edges if desired and hang the curtains using your preferred method.
